WebPartitiondivision (also known as partitive, sharing and grouping division) is a way of understanding division in which you divide an amount into a given number of groups. If you are thinking about division this way, then 12 ÷ 3 means 12 things divided evenly among 3 groups, and we wish to know how many is in 1 (each) group. WebBuilding Division . Topic C is designed to deepen students’ understanding of spatial structuring as they build and partition rectangles with rows and columns of same-size squares. In Lessons 10 and 11, students compose a rectangle by making tile arrays with no gaps or overlaps. Lesson 12 introduces the added complexity of composing a rectangle by ...
